What is the cheapest month to fly to Perth?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ights to Perth,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ights to Perth is October, where tickets cost $1,528 on average for one-way flights.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and January, where the average cost of tickets from South Africa is $1,912 and $1,891 respectively. For return trips, the best month to travel is February with an average price of $1,331.

What is a good deal for flights to Perth?

If you’re looking for cheap airfare to Perth, 25% of our users found tickets to Perth for the following prices or less: From Johannesburg OR Tambo Airport $1,165 one-way - $1,552 return.

How far in advance should I book a flight to Perth?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ights to Perth,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 32 days before departure.

FAQs - booking Perth flights

  • How far is Perth Airport from central Perth?

    There are 10 km between Perth city centre and Perth Airport.

  • What is the name of Perth’s airport?

    There is only 1 airport in Perth, called Perth Airport (PER). It can also be referred to as Perth.

  • How much is a flight to Perth?

    On average, a flight to Perth costs $1,680. The cheapest price found on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ks cost $901 and departed from Johannesburg OR Tambo Airport.

  • What is the cheapest day to fly to Perth?

    Based on KAYAK data, the cheapest day to fly to Perth is Monday where tickets can be as cheap as $1,615. On the other hand, the most expensive day to fly is Friday, where prices are $1,895 on average.
